so i heard you are talking about yun
here is some stuff I know
my combos
bnb: c.lp c.lk. s.lp s.mp rh.upkicks
dive kick combo: divekick, c.lp c.lk. s.lp s.mp rh.upkicks
dive kick combo (short hit confirm): divekick c.lp s.lp c.mp s.mp rh.upkicks (more damge)
punisher: c.mp c.mp s.mp rh.upkicks
dirty: c.lp c.lk. s.lp s.mp lk.shoulder, super
footsie /gimmicks
command grab setup: (stuff), divekick, c.lp , ex.grab, c.mp, s.mp, rh.upkicks
(stuff) lp.palms, ex.grab, c.mp, s.mp, rh.upkicks
ultra 1 setup: ex.lunge, ultra 1, hp.lunge
divekick stuff: neutral jump.mk (fake dive)
cross up w/ lk.divekick
footsie: s.lk buffer lp.lunge
c.mk buffer mp.lunge
s.mp, s.hp
counterhit setups: +frame dive c.mp

thats all ive got, still alot to learn but thats enough for anyone looking to start practicing yun

I don't get why people are choosing to do c.lp c.lk s.lp as opposed to c.lk c.lp s.lp. c.lk hits low while c.lp does not. The only time to start with c.lp is after a blocked ex lunge or something to counterhit the opponent mashing jab or cr.tech.

Ending with rh upkicks against everyone is not a good idea since it will whiff on some people, most notably it will whiff on shotos after that string.

On June 18 2011 17:38 exalted wrote:
Anyone know about stun data and what special does the most stun? (lunge/shoudler/upkicks) Would be useful to know which one to go for if we feel the opp is close to stun, since Yun has suchhhh damaging combos after stun (EX palm -> shoulder -> lunge or palm -> launcher -> ultra/EX upkicks in corner).


shoulder: 200 stun, EX 250 stun
lunge punch: 150 stun, EX 200 stun
upkicks: lk & mk 150 stun, rh & EX 200 stun
palm: 250 stun, EX 300 stun

your best stun punishes are s.mp xx lp shoulder (300) or s.mp xx EX shoulder (350). all other options do less stun, or need a meter to break 300, in which case EX shoulder wins anyway. if you're in range for c.mp, then c.mp s.mp xx EX shoulder does 400 stun
